vesgantti-2-seater-sofa-164cm-fabric-loveseat-sofa-with-bilateral-pocket-storage-upholstered-couch-perfect-for-living-room-bedroom-office-small-space-tool-free-assembly-164l-76d-85hcm-grey-649.jpgChoosing Between a 2 Seater Leather and Fabric Sofa

It can be difficult to decide between 2 seater fabric and leather when you're looking for a new sofa. This is especially true for those who aren't a professional in furniture.

If you have kids or live in a small apartment, the leather option may be best for you. It is easy to clean and looks stunning in a lot of homes.

Comfort

The sofa is often the focal point in many homes and is an important purchase. You want a sofa that is comfortable to sit on for hours, looks great, fits to your style and will endure the test of time. Deciding between leather or fabric isn't easy, but it is important to assess your priorities, lifestyle and budget before making a choice.

Leather is a high-end material that has a luxurious feel and oozes elegance in the home. It is durable and stain-resistant. It is also resistant to pets and children, and will last for a long time if properly cared for. It can be costly up front and may need regular conditioning to avoid cracking or peeling.

Fabric sofas are available in a wide range of styles, colours and fabrics. They can be an affordable alternative to a leather one. They are also more comfortable and more inviting, and can be "broken into" right from the beginning. They can be prone to dust mites and pet hairs, and may need frequent cleaning. However, thanks to advances in technologies and performance fabrics, there are now hypoallergenic options available.

Fabric sofas can last for up to 15 years if they're maintained properly. Regular vacuuming and deep cleaning help to keep the fabric clean and free of stains and odours. They also tend to flatten and sag as time passes, just like leather. In addition, a lot of fabric couches have been treated with chemicals to make them stain-resistant and flame retardant. They can release volatile organic chemicals that could cause allergic reactions and impact the quality of air in the indoors.

Durability

We typically choose sofas 2 seater fabric with fabrics that are durable, particularly if you have children or pets. You don't need to spend a lot of money upfront in case you'll regret it after the first stain or claw. Similarly, you don't want to purchase something that is cheap but doesn't stand up to daily use.

Leather is also extremely durable with a tremendous tear strength. It can last for up to four times longer than fabric and is innately resistant to fading, cracking, and flaking. It can be conditioned to replenish its natural oils, and make it appear new.

Fabrics are a more affordable alternative and are available in a variety of colours patterns, patterns, and textures to fit any design. They are also less difficult to clean than leather and can withstand a significant amount of wear and tear but they do tend to be more prone to moisture and suffer from fading as time passes.

Microfiber is a good option for its durability and comes in a wide variety of colours, but it's not as tough as genuine leather and will not be able to take the punishment of scratches. However, it's an excellent choice for families because of its resilience to spills and stains, and it is easy to clean, generally with a damp cloth.

Suede however is a challenge to clean and may be even more difficult to repair than leather. It can also lose its shape if not conditioned and can feel quite rough to the roughness of the. It is also a thin material, so it might not be as durable as sheepskin and cowhide leather.

Allergens

Fabrics can have a significant effect on allergies. It is important to understand how different options perform. Fabrics tends to retain allergens, such as dust mites and pet dander, which can cause symptoms such as asthma, hay fever rhinitis and eczema. This is due to the fact that these fabrics provide the perfect environment to allow them to grow.

The leather, however is not a source of these allergens, and offers a constant level of comfort, regardless of season. It can also trigger allergic dermatitis in those with contact dermatitis or are allergic to tanning chemicals. To minimize skin reactions, it is important to use vegetable-tanned products and maintain a vigilant skincare routine.

Both sofas made of fabric and leather are robust, but the fabric you choose will have a significant impact on how well your sofa is able to stand up to wear. A top-quality fabric will not suffer from fading or sagging and can withstand spills, body oils and daily use. Modern fabric couches are often equipped with stain-resistant treatments to make cleaning easy.

While you might not be able completely prevent an allergic reaction from the leather sofa, it is possible to avoid allergens by keeping a lint roller close by and regularly vacuuming your living area. This can help reduce the amount of dirt, pet hair and dust mites that gather on your sofa. If you're still suffering from allergies, try replacing your sofa with a hypoallergenic one. For example, a leather sofa made of vinyl or synthetic leather is less likely to trap dust mites and pet dander. It also can help you breathe more easily.

Scratches

When purchasing a leather sofa, you need to consider how much wear and tear you can expect from it. The length of time a sofa will last depends on the finish, colour and leather quality. You should also make sure it's sturdy enough to withstand spillages or other accidents. This can be achieved by selecting a couch that has a hardwood frame and high-density foam cushions.

Leather can be damaged for various reasons, including stretching and marking the territory or reliving stress. Scratches vary in severity and range from minor surface scratches to severe punctures and cuts. Small scratches can be fixed by applying a conditioner for leather to the affected area. This will restore the equilibrium between moisture and oil in the leather and stop it from drying out or cracking. Deep scratches and cut may require a different treatment, depending on the amount of damage.

It is a good idea for cat owners to trim their cats' nails regularly. This will stop them from scratching the sofa. You can also redirect your cat's scratching behavior by offering alternatives to scratching surfaces, like cardboard or sisal rope. You can also apply a pet-safe furniture polish that you can apply using a a soft clean cloth.

In addition to cleaning your leather couch regularly, it is also a good idea to keep it from direct sunlight and sources of heat which can dry out the leather. This could cause it to split and is often difficult to repair and frequently requires the reupholstery. Make use of a leather conditioner in order to keep the leather supple.
